Students do not simply prompt a chatbot. They design, build and test a code-based AI agent that plans a research path, retrieves information from approved sources, compares evidence, flags uncertainty and pauses for human review before providing an answer.

The Search AI Agent can:

  • Accept a research question and break it into sub-questions
  • Plan which information sources to check and in what order
  • Retrieve content from approved, pre-selected sources
  • Compare evidence across multiple sources for consistency
  • Detect conflicting or missing information
  • Add citations to every claim in the response
  • Flag uncertainty and state what it does not know
  • Pause for human review before delivering the final answer

How is this different from a chatbot tutorial?
Chatbot tutorials teach students to write better prompts. This workshop teaches students to build the system behind the chatbot: an agent that plans, retrieves, evaluates and explains, with safety guardrails and human review built in.
